  • AudioFile Reviews : AudioFile Reviews 2008 February/March
    Hundreds of people are attending a benefit at San Francisco's Ritz-Carlton Hotel when an earthquake occurs. Narrator Tom Dheere sidesteps a somewhat predictable plot with his portrayal of a small group of survivors as they come together at a shelter. They soon learn that the aftershocks in their personal lives will be more devastating than the quake itself. Dheere deftly carves out speech patterns for each of the main characters. Pop singer Melanie Free, from Southern California, has just the right amount of youth in her voice, which contrasts well with the older voices of Sarah and Seth Sloane, a well-to-do couple from Northern California. Photojournalist Everett Carson has a credible Montana drawl. Dheere's secondary characters are also well defined but restrained--so they don't overshadow the primary characters. G.O. (c) AudioFile 2008, Portland, Maine
